Why AI matters at this scale

The City of Saratoga Springs, Utah, is a mid-sized municipal government serving a rapidly growing suburban community of around 50,000 residents. With a workforce of 201-500 employees, the city manages a broad portfolio of services — from public safety and utilities to parks, planning, and building permits — all while facing the classic constraints of local government: tight budgets, limited IT staff, and rising citizen expectations for digital convenience. AI adoption at this scale is not about futuristic experiments; it’s about practical automation that stretches every tax dollar and frees up staff to focus on high-touch community needs. For cities in this size band, even a 10-15% efficiency gain in high-volume processes can translate into hundreds of hours saved annually, directly improving service delivery without adding headcount.

Three concrete AI opportunities with ROI framing

1. Citizen Service Automation
The highest-impact opportunity is deploying a conversational AI chatbot on the city website and mobile portal. Residents frequently call or email with repetitive questions about utility billing, park reservations, business licenses, and event schedules. A GPT-powered assistant, trained on the city’s knowledge base and integrated with backend systems, can resolve 60-70% of these inquiries instantly, 24/7. This reduces call center volume, cuts average handle time, and improves resident satisfaction scores. ROI is measurable within months through reduced staff overtime and faster inquiry resolution.

2. Intelligent Permit and License Processing
Building permits, business licenses, and planning applications involve manual document review that bogs down staff and frustrates applicants. AI-driven document understanding can automatically classify submissions, extract key data fields, check for completeness, and flag anomalies. For a growing city like Saratoga Springs, where construction activity is brisk, this can slash permit review cycles by 30-40%, accelerate revenue collection, and reduce the administrative burden on planners and inspectors. The payback comes from faster turnaround, fewer errors, and improved builder relationships.

3. Predictive Maintenance for Infrastructure
The city manages water, sewer, roads, and public facilities. By applying machine learning to sensor data (water flow, pressure, traffic counts) and work order history, Saratoga Springs can shift from reactive to predictive maintenance. The system identifies patterns that precede pipe breaks or road failures, allowing crews to intervene before costly emergencies occur. This reduces overtime, extends asset life, and minimizes service disruptions. Even a modest reduction in emergency repairs can save tens of thousands of dollars annually.

Deployment risks specific to this size band

For a city of 201-500 employees, the primary risks are not technological but organizational. First, data privacy and security are paramount — citizen data handled by AI must comply with Utah’s GRAMA laws and cybersecurity standards. Second, change management is critical: frontline staff may fear job displacement, so leadership must frame AI as a co-pilot, not a replacement. Third, integration with legacy systems (often on-premise Tyler Technologies or similar) can be complex and require vendor cooperation. Finally, algorithmic bias must be guarded against, especially in code enforcement or public safety use cases, to ensure equitable treatment across all neighborhoods. Starting with low-risk, high-transparency use cases like chatbots and document processing builds trust and momentum for broader AI adoption.

What does the City of Saratoga Springs do?
It is a municipal government providing public services such as police, fire, parks, recreation, utilities, planning, and building permits to approximately 50,000 residents in Utah County.
Why is AI relevant for a city of this size?
With 201-500 employees serving a growing population, AI can automate repetitive tasks, stretch limited resources, and improve citizen experience without proportional headcount increases.
What is the biggest AI quick win for Saratoga Springs?
A citizen-facing chatbot integrated with the city website can instantly reduce call volumes for common questions, freeing staff for higher-value work and improving response times.
How can AI help with building permits?
AI can pre-screen applications for completeness, classify documents, and flag missing items, cutting manual review time and accelerating approvals for residents and builders.
What are the risks of AI adoption for a small city?
Key risks include data privacy concerns, integration with legacy systems, staff resistance, and ensuring AI decisions are transparent and equitable for all residents.
Are there affordable AI tools for local governments?
Yes, many govtech vendors now offer subscription-based AI modules for chatbots, document processing, and analytics that fit small-city budgets and require minimal IT support.
